continuous plan
[kən-ˈtin-yə-wəs plan]
nounpl: continuous plans
plano contínuo
1. A service or subscription plan that automatically renews and continues indefinitely until the customer cancels it
The gym offers a continuous plan that charges your account monthly.
A academia oferece um plano contínuo que cobra sua conta mensalmente.
2. In business and project management, an ongoing strategy or program without a defined end date
Our company implemented a continuous plan for employee training and development.
Nossa empresa implementou um plano contínuo para treinamento e desenvolvimento de funcionários.
3. A subscription or membership arrangement that automatically renews unless explicitly canceled
Be careful when signing up for a continuous plan; you may forget to cancel it.
Tenha cuidado ao se inscrever em um plano contínuo; você pode esquecer de cancelá-lo.
Continuous plans are particularly prevalent in Brazil and the USA in streaming services (Netflix, Spotify), gyms, and software-as-a-service (SaaS) products. Consumer protection agencies in both countries have issued warnings about automatic renewals, leading to regulations requiring explicit opt-in and easy cancellation options. In Brazilian Portuguese, this concept is increasingly common in the digital economy, and consumers are becoming more aware of the need to monitor and cancel unused continuous plans.
